Reducing Seed Shattering in Weedy Rice by Editing <i>SH4</i> and <i>qSH1</i> Genes: Implications in Environmental Biosafety and Weed Control through Transgene Mitigation

Mitigating the function of acquired transgenes in crop wild/weedy relatives can provide an ideal strategy to reduce the possible undesired environmental impacts of pollen-mediated transgene flow from genetically engineered (GE) crops.
